OUR GARDEN SQUARES.
STONE KERBING AGAIN ADVOCATED. The Pahiatua Chamber of Commerce wrote to tho Borough Council ms follows: “By resolution passed by members at the annual meeting of this Chamber, held on 21st ultimo. 1 have to urge upon your Council the advisab - ity of placing stone kcrbiim rum the public squares in Main Street. “I would direct your attention to the letter from the then secretary of the Chamber addressed to toe Town Clerk on the 21st DeccmJ-r. 1928. in which the views oi tho Chamber were fully set out, and to the reply dated 28th January following in winch the Town Clerk w us directed to say that the matter was. under the consideration of the Council.” Tiie Mayor said that the Works Committee had dealt with this matter in its report.
